Alexandra Spieth is an actor, writer, and director based in Astoria, Queens. She has directed two feature films. From 2022-2025, Alexandra was a lecturer of on-camera acting at the Mason Gross School of the Arts at Rutgers University and directed the 2023 and 2024 Digital Showcase. She is in pre-production for her third feature film, O COUNTRY.

Alexandra has performed in over 30 shorts and 20 Equity Productions. She created, wrote, and starred in the independent series “86’d” which was executive produced and fully funded by BRIC TV. She created, wrote, and starred in 4 seasons of the independent series “Blank My Life”. She’s one of the founders of “ArtBuffet” a monthly variety show at the Irondale Space. Additionally, Alexandra is a member of NYWIFT, FilmShop, and Film Fatales. She is the recipient of the George A. Romero Fellowship, an Orchard Project alum, and LIFF Artist of the “Write by the Beach” program.

She trained as an actor at Carnegie Mellon University where she received a BFA in Acting (winner of the Adelyne Roth Levine Memorial Award for Excellence in Acting).

Professional Credits
-Writer, Director, and Executive Producer on independent feature "Stag"
-Director of independent feature "I Know Exactly How You Die"
-Former Lecturer of On-Camera Acting and Director of the BFA Acting Digital Showcase at Rutgers University (2022-2025)
-Writer, Creator, and Star of independent series "86'd" and "Blank My Life"
Industry Awards
George A. Romero Fellowship from Salem Horror Fest (2023), "Best Director" from Renegade Film Festival (2023), "Best Director of a Feature" from GenreBlast Film festival (2022), "Best Thrills and Chills Feature Film" from Female Eye Film Festival (2022), "Adelyne Roth Levine Memorial Award for Excellence in Acting" from Carnegie Mellon University (2013).
